• Willkommen im Linux Club - dem deutschsprachigen Supportforum für GNU/Linux. Registriere dich kostenlos, um alle Inhalte zu sehen und Fragen zu stellen.

[gelöst] - Frage zur 2000 Anmeldung

Hallo zusammen,
ich habe folgendes Problem: Ich habe erfolgreich einen Win2000 PC (Computername Vancouver) unter Samba (als PDC) angemeldet.
Beim Versuch noch eien Rechner mit Win2000 (Computername Nelson) in die Domäne einzubinden tritt immer die folgende Fehlermeldung auf: " Bei dem Versuch der Domäne "WORKGROUP" beizutreten trat folgender Fehler auf: Der Benutzername konnte nicht gefunden werden". Scheint so als könnte ich mit root den PC nicht in die Domäne bringen.
root habe ich aber mit smbpasswd -a root der Sambadatenbank bekannt gemacht. Gibt auch einen Eintrag für root in der smbpasswd. Hat ja auch mit dem anderen Rechner (Vancouver) funktioniert. Hab auch vorher mit useradd -g ntclients -s /bin/false Nelson$ für den neuen PC einen Maschinenaccount angelegt.

Was mir noch aufgefallen ist, ist dass in der smbpasswd auch ein Eintrag für den Maschinenaccount vom Rechner Vancouver existiert. Ist das ok ? Wenn ja, warum ist dann kein Eintrag für den Rechner Nelson vorhanden (ich tippe mal, weil ich ihn noch nich in der Domäne angemeldet habe)

Woran könnte das liegen ?

HIer meine smb.conf:

[global]
workgroup = WORKGROUP
netbios name = Arktur
bind interfaces only = Yes
map to guest = Bad User
username map = /etc/samba/smbusers
password level = 2
load printers = No
printcap cache time = 750
logon script = logon.bat
logon path = \\%L\profiles\.msprofile
logon drive = z:
logon home = \\%L\%U\.9xprofile
domain logons = Yes
os level = 65
preferred master = Yes
domain master = Yes
ldap ssl = no
lock directory = /var/lock
message command = /bin/bash -c 'rm %s' &
cups options = raw
map archive = No
mangled names = No
include = /etc/samba/smb.conf.proj

[netlogon]
path = /etc/samba/scripts
valid users = root, @lehrer
write list = adm, root
read only = No
guest ok = Yes

[homes]
comment = Stammverzeichnis
path = /home1/%S
read only = No
create mask = 0755
veto files = /etc/bin/
hide files = /.*/
browseable = No
exec = /bin/bash -c 'cat /etc/motd | /usr/samba/bin/smbclient -M %m -I %I' &
wide links = No

[tmp]
comment = Datenaustausch
path = /pub/tmp
read only = No
guest ok = Yes
wide links = No

[pub]
comment = Unterrichtsmaterial
path = /pub/adm
valid users = root, @lehrer
admin users = root, gerhards
read only = No
guest ok = Yes

[a]
comment = Diskette in Laufwerk A
path = /a
read only = No
guest ok = Yes
wide links = No

[cdrom]
comment = Die (erste) CDROM
path = /cdrom
guest ok = Yes

[protokolle]
path = /pub/protokoll
read only = No

[Formulare]
comment = Formularvorlagen
path = /pub/Formulare
read only = No
guest ok = Yes

edit Mod: auf gelöst gesetzt 19.11.05
 
Schau Dir hier mal die ausführliche Aufstellung von der config von rolle an:
http://www.linux-club.de/viewtopic.php?t=23074&highlight=

ev. muss an dem neuen PC noch was umgestellt werden.
 
OP
U

uwe

Hallo,

schlagt mich, aber ich find auf der angegebenen Seite keine config ??

Grüsse
Uwe
 
War ja auch der falsche Link. :wink:
http://www.linux-club.de/viewtopic.php?t=41151&highlight=
Es muß natürlich für den Rechner auch ein Maschinenaccount auf Sambaebene existieren. Also entweder, Du legst ihn noch direkt auf dem Server an, oder Du integrierst in Deine smb.conf ein 'add machine script', das dann wenn nötig den Account selbst anlegt, wenn Du mit einem Client der Domäne beitrittst.
 
OP
U

uwe

Hallo,

ich dachte der Befehl useradd -g ntclients -s /bin/false Nelson$ legt den Maschienenaccount auf Sambaebene an ? So hab ich es zumindest aus den Video Tutorials, die ja wirklich gut sind, gelernt. Was müsste ich denn sonst noch machen ? Ich glaub auch nicht, dass ich für den Rechner "Vancouver" viel anders gemacht habe als für den PC "Nelson" (zumindest kann ich mich nicht daran erinnern :) ).

Danke schon mal

Grüsse
Uwe
 
Ich habe die Videos gerade nicht zur Hand, aber wenn die Existenz des Accounts in der smbpasswd der einzige Unterschied zwischen den beiden Clients ist, liegt die Vermutung nach, daß dort der Fehler liegt.
useradd legt meines Wissens Nutzerinnen auf Linuxebene an. Da ich aber meine Machinenaccount immer automatisch anlege, bin ich mir nicht sicher, ob der Sambaaccount beim Einhängen in die Domäne erst erstellt wird. Lege doch einfach mal mit smbpasswd einen Account an.
 
Keine Ahnung, ich arbeite immer mit einer anderen Datenbank. Frage einfach mal die Manpage oder suche hier im Forum.
 
Oben